Walter J. Ackerman v. Callaway Contracting, Inc., et al.

Date:

July 2005

Venue:

Norfolk Superior Court
Dedham, Massachusetts

Case Summary:

The plaintiff, Walter Ackerman, brought suit against Callaway Contracting and our client, T.J. Blume & Son, Inc., alleging that he was working on a construction site in East Boston, Massachusetts when he was struck by the bucket of a backhoe, causing him to sustain serious personal injuries. The plaintiff alleged that the negligent operation by the defendants, or either of them, was the cause of this accident. He further alleged that our client was the owner of the Bobcat tractor involved in this incident. We were able to successfully establish that the plaintiff was unable to prove that the Bobcat was owned by T.J. Blume, or that our client had any such equipment at the site at time of the incident.

Results:

Summary judgment was granted by Judge Patrick Brady on behalf of our client.
